Epilogue

Since the publication of Boulding’s Evolutionary Economics (1981), the area of study has exploded, which a Google search of the Internet will support. Also, Wikipedia has an entry which identifies some leading contributors to and publications in the field. Similar and often overlapping ideas can be found under the subject titles of institutional economics, complexity economics, and complex adaptive systems. I found fascinating the work undertaken at the Santa Fe Institute in 1987–88 (Waldrop, 2002, 133–51 and 247–62). One outcome was the acknowledgement (Ibid., 326–7) by Kenneth Arrow that viewing the economy as a complex adaptive system was another valid way to do economics equal of status to the traditional theory. A similar process of analysis, e.g. biological modeling, used by Boulding is found in Beinhocker (2006, 11–20 and 187–379). Also, he relates subsequent activities on Wall Street undertaken by some of the economics program participants (2006, 381–414).

Two journals publishing papers in evolutionary economic theory are: Journal of Economic Issues (www.afee.net/division.php?page=jei) and Journal of Evolutionary Economics (www.springer.com/economics/journal/191).
